About this work

The painting depicts a woman kneeling on a red cushion, her hands clasped together in prayer. She wears a long, white dress with a red vest and a white apron. In front of her is a small table with a white tablecloth, holding a book and a rosary. The room is decorated with various objects, including a clock, a vase, and several paintings on the walls. To the right of the woman, three men stand, two of them in military uniforms. The room's decor suggests a sense of elegance and refinement. The overall atmosphere of the painting is one of quiet contemplation and devotion. The artist's use of chiaroscuro creates a sense of depth and dimensionality in the painting.
